Absence Policy

• Students have the number of days absent to make up the work that was missed.

• Students take responsibility to pick up handouts and discuss with teacher what they need to complete and turn in.

• Please avoid non-illness absences whenever possible.

Page 9: Welcome to  6 th  Grade Science!

Grading Policy

• 50 % Classwork – activities, labs, assignments, participation, safety, notebook.

• 40% Tests, quizzes and other assessments.• 10% “Other” – homework, teamwork, etc.

Homework

• Assigned on Friday, due the following Wednesday.• Homework is online, using Newsela.com, Google

docs, and other online resources.• Paper copies provided for anyone who needs

them.• Homework is assessed for completion and effort,

not graded.• Check the class webpage each Friday for the new

assignment.

First Quarter

• Science Skills and Inquiry– Design & conduct investigations

• Plant Systems– Experiments with Plants

• Cell Structure and Function– Structure & hierarchy of cells

Page 14: Welcome to  6 th  Grade Science!

Second Quarter

• Human Body Systems– How various systems work together to

form vital functions

• Scientific Method– Step-by-step process for conducting

scientific inquiry

Page 15: Welcome to  6 th  Grade Science!

Third Quarter

• Science Project

• Structure of the Earth– Earth’s atmosphere– Earth’s waters (oceans)– Water cycle– Earth’s weather

Page 16: Welcome to  6 th  Grade Science!

Third Quarter Science Project

• Design and conduct an experiment at home

• Create a Power Point presentation, trifold, or a video

• Give speech to class on experiment

Page 17: Welcome to  6 th  Grade Science!

Fourth Quarter

• Structure of the Earth - continues– Earth’s atmosphere– Earth’s waters (oceans)– Water Cycle– Earth’s weather

• Energy– Renewable and non-renewable– Generated, stored, transferred, transformed– Conservation
